Welcome to /rice/, for all your desktop and phone ricing needs! Rules are at 8ch.net/rice/rules.html, see pic related for settings.

>What is ricing?

Ricing is the art of making your desktop/phone look pretty my installing software (rainmeter, another WM or DE, etc…) and modifying configuration files.

Found this widget https://play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=de.devmil.minimaltext a couple days ago and been playing around with it. It's pretty cool.

As far as pics related goes, I can't decide which looks better. The one I chose for now is the smaller text. I also had one with just the time part, and made a battery one but it didn't look as good on the same page and I didn't really want another page.

You can also do sideways vertical text, or just have regular numbers. Other things you can display include battery percentage, temp, voltage; CPU temp, speed; RAM; bandwidth; and more.

Yea soz bruvda, been super busy submitting papers to journals and shit because I'm a nerd. So here's what's going down, I got four packages now-

SNUX is a Winux overhaul, meaning a Windows7 rice & mod package designed to make

Windows look and function more like Linux.

SPOR is a portable desktop deployment designed for SecOps and Win-program replacement.

SHAX is a portable skiddie toolkit designed for local, wardriving, and remote tasks.

The programs bundled in SHAX are based on this program list - http://snerx.com/trenches

SPAX is the combination of all three other packs, intended to make for a full distro

deployment of Windows7 fully riced and modified to look and feel like Linux SecOps.

I updated the page for this a little bit - http://snerx.com/winux

The reason I separated them was so the ricing would be its own thing and all the extra programs, 'debloating' of windows via alternative programs to its undesirable vanilla programs, would be their own thing. first open about:config

to protect against SSLv3 exploit you can use the mozilla addon "SSL version control"

or set security.tls.version.min = 1 in about:config for Mozilla Firefox.

To restore change the value back to the security.tls.version.min = 0. That's it.

In Mozilla Thunderbird you can set it also in about:config, which You can find in: Tools → Options → Advanced → General → Config Editor.
